"Together, they opened Lincoln Blue Sushi in 2014. Since then, Blue Sushi has expanded rapidly. The chain now operates 16 locations around the United States, emphasizing sustainable fishing and sourcing practices." - Brooke Jackson-Glidden

Located in the heart of Lincoln’s Haymarket district, Blue Sushi Sake Grill consistently earns top marks from local publications like the Lincoln Journal Star and is highlighted in the Omaha World-Herald for its vibrant atmosphere and creative menu. This independently owned spot is celebrated for its commitment to both sustainable seafood and innovative rolls, offering everything from classic nigiri to inventive vegan options. The colorful, contemporary décor and lively bar scene make it a destination for both sushi aficionados and newcomers seeking a fun night out. Their dedication to responsibly sourced fish and a dynamic sake list ensures every visit is as conscientious as it is delicious.

Highlight: Iguana roll The Iguana $13/6 pieces - Shrimp tempura, crab mix, fresh water eel, avocado, serrano, yellow soy paper, cucumber wrap, ponzu, and eel sauce. This roll was light and refreshing. It doesn't have any rice in it and was tasty. Spider Maki $13/10 pieces - Crispy soft shell crab mix, spicy mayo, smelt roe, avocado, cucumber. Decent spider roll, the rice was a little mushy. Conveniently located next to the Courtyard, you can just walk next door if you are staying here.
